The ceramic brings together exceptionally high hardness with very low density and is also As a result optimally fitted to light-weight solutions in private protection and for lining land and air cars.

The B₁₂ icosahedra and bridging carbons kind a network plane that runs parallel into the c-aircraft and stacks along the c-axis, forming a layered composition. The B₁₂ icosahedron along with the B6 octahedron are the two essential structural units of your lattice. The B₆ octahedra are much too smaller to bind due to their modest sizing. Instead, they bind towards the B₁₂ icosahedra while in the neighbouring layer, which weakens the c-aircraft bonding.

the power of boron carbide to absorb neutrons devoid of forming very long-lived radionuclides can make it eye-catching being an absorbent for neutron radiation arising in nuclear energy vegetation and from anti-personnel neutron bombs.

Boron Carbide has become the most difficult materials identified to humanity, surpassed only by diamond and cubic boron nitride.

Boron carbide was discovered while in the 19th century being a by-product of reactions involving metallic borides, but its chemical components was not known. It click here was not right up until the 1930s the chemical composition was believed as B4C.[4]

Boron carbide (chemical formulation close to B4C) is a particularly hard boron–carbon ceramic and covalent material. It is without doubt one of the most difficult materials identified, ranking third guiding diamond and cubic boron nitride. it really is the toughest material generated in tonnage quantities.
